This insightful and thought-provoking book explores 50 of the most commonly cited inconsistencies, offering well-researched explanations and shedding light on the context, interpretations, and deeper meanings behind these perceived discrepancies. Written by a team of knowledgeable biblical scholars and theologians, this comprehensive guide navigates through complex passages, genealogies, and accounts, providing a thorough understanding of the historical, cultural, and literary contexts that can often be misunderstood or overlooked.
